Embodiment
The utility model is further illustrated with reference to the accompanying drawings and examples:
Embodiment 1:A kind of Tower-type aerator system, referring to Fig. 1, Fig. 2;The system it include the internal pond for being provided with cavity volume
Body, pond body is interior to be arranged at intervals in pond body side by side at least provided with multigroup aerator A, B, multigroup aerator A, B.
Specifically, single described aerator includes several aerators 5, it also includes being made up of several tracheaes 4
Aerator mounting bracket 2,3;Several tracheaes 4 in aerator mounting bracket 2,3 are interconnected and set in fenestral fabric, institute
The bottom that aerator mounting bracket 2,3 is placed horizontally at pond body 1 is stated, several aerators 5 are arranged at the upside of aerator mounting bracket
Face, and each aerator 5 is connected by a check-valves with the gas channels inside aerator mounting bracket respectively;Certainly, the system it
Also include the air inlet pipe 11 connected with the gas channels inside aerator mounting bracket, the inlet end of air inlet pipe 11 is located at outside pond body
And it is corresponding with air pump connection, air-flow is passed sequentially through by air inlet pipe by the effect of air pump, aerator mounting bracket 2,3 be delivered to it is each
In aerator.Each aerator is connected by a check-valves with the gas channels inside aerator mounting bracket respectively.
Further, the lower surface of described aerator mounting bracket is provided with support base 9, and the aerator mounting bracket passes through
Support base 9 is vacantly arranged at the bottom of pond body 1, and support base is channel-section steel, by this support base by the hanging setting of aerator mounting bracket
The precipitation of lower dirt in pond body/biological tank can be avoided to bury aerator.
Further, several tracheaes in the system are the rectangular square tube of internal diameter, are also installed in the aerator
The drip pipe 10 connected with the gas channels inside the aerator mounting bracket, drip pipe are additionally provided with below frame
10 end is provided with check-valves/draining valve, sets drip pipe to ensure to exclude the condensed water in pipeline when needed,
Avoid the blocking of pipeline, it is ensured that the stabilization of efficiency is aerated, meanwhile, extend the service life of the system.
Further, the system is also respectively equipped with longitudinal chute 6, the aeration in two side walls of the pond body being oppositely arranged
Device mounting bracket 2, the end of 3 both sides are provided with the axis of guide 7, and the elongated end of the axis of guide 7 is located in longitudinal chute 6, and described
Aerator mounting bracket 2,3 can be moved up and down by guiding up and down of the axis of guide 7 in longitudinal chute, and aerator is pacified in order to realize
The lifting shelved, the system also include the hawser for being arranged at aerator mounting bracket both sides(In the lower end of hawser and figure at label 8
Connected at the lower end fixing point 8 of hawser), now, the upper end of the hawser be located above pond body and with the boom hoisting of outside(If
It is placed in driving or other hoisting machines of pond body both sides etc.)Connection, now, the air inlet pipe are flexible pipe or are that can dock at least
Two air intake branch docking form;A certain group of aerator in pond body can be promoted to by pond body by the boom hoisting of outside
Interior ullage, aerator can be repaired, safeguarded by this mode, this design can be avoided the occurrence of because aerator is tieed up
The occurrence of biological tank stops production caused by changing is built by laying, the raising for the treatment effeciency of the biological tank in sewage treatment plant has
Huge help.
